加法運算子
1、移位運算子
2、 關係運算符
3、相等運算子
4、 位與運算子
5、位異或運算子
6、 位或運算子
7、 邏輯與運算子
8、 邏輯或運算子
9、 三元條件運算子
10、 賦值運算子 12、逗號運算子 13、優先順序功能介紹:1、賦值語句的作用是把某個常量或變數或表示式的值賦值給另一個變數。符號為‘=’。這裡並不是等於的意思,只是賦值,等於用‘==’表示;2、算術運算子在C語言中有兩個單目和五個雙目運算子;3、邏輯運算子是根據表示式的值來返回真值或是假值。其實在C語言中沒有所謂的真值和假值,只是認為非0為真值,0為假值;4、關係運算符是對兩個表示式進行比較,返回一個真/假值;5、自增自減運算子,這是一類特殊的運算子,自增運算子++和自減運算子--對變數的操作結果是增加1和減少1;6、賦值運算子,還有一類C/C++獨有的複合賦值運算子。它們實際上是一種縮寫形式,使得對變數的改變更為簡潔;7、條件運算子(?:)是C語言中唯一的一個三目運算子,它是對第一個表示式作真/假檢測,然後根據結果返回兩外兩個表示式中的一個;8、逗號運算子在C語言中,多個表示式可以用逗號分開,其中用逗號分開的表示式的值分別結算,但整個表示式的值是最後一個表示式的值;9、優先順序和結合性,這些運算子計算時都有一定的順序,就好象先要算乘除後算加減一樣。優先順序和結合性是運算子兩個重要的特性,結合性又稱為計算順序,它決定組成表示式的各個部分是否參與計算以及什麼時候計算。
加法運算子
1、移位運算子
2、 關係運算符
3、相等運算子
4、 位與運算子
5、位異或運算子
6、 位或運算子
7、 邏輯與運算子
8、 邏輯或運算子
9、 三元條件運算子
10、 賦值運算子 12、逗號運算子 13、優先順序功能介紹:1、賦值語句的作用是把某個常量或變數或表示式的值賦值給另一個變數。符號為‘=’。這裡並不是等於的意思,只是賦值,等於用‘==’表示;2、算術運算子在C語言中有兩個單目和五個雙目運算子;3、邏輯運算子是根據表示式的值來返回真值或是假值。其實在C語言中沒有所謂的真值和假值,只是認為非0為真值,0為假值;4、關係運算符是對兩個表示式進行比較,返回一個真/假值;5、自增自減運算子,這是一類特殊的運算子,自增運算子++和自減運算子--對變數的操作結果是增加1和減少1;6、賦值運算子,還有一類C/C++獨有的複合賦值運算子。它們實際上是一種縮寫形式,使得對變數的改變更為簡潔;7、條件運算子(?:)是C語言中唯一的一個三目運算子,它是對第一個表示式作真/假檢測,然後根據結果返回兩外兩個表示式中的一個;8、逗號運算子在C語言中,多個表示式可以用逗號分開,其中用逗號分開的表示式的值分別結算,但整個表示式的值是最後一個表示式的值;9、優先順序和結合性,這些運算子計算時都有一定的順序,就好象先要算乘除後算加減一樣。優先順序和結合性是運算子兩個重要的特性,結合性又稱為計算順序,它決定組成表示式的各個部分是否參與計算以及什麼時候計算。